· A problem for solving mass balances in mineral processing plants is the calculation of circulating load in closed circuits. A family of possible methods to the resolution of this calculation is the iterative methods consisting of a finite loop where each iteration the initial solution is refined in order to move closer to the exact solution.

· of circulating load and classification efficiency is difficult to quantify in practice as these two parameters are inherently interrelated. Even though mill capacity increases with circulating load an optimum circulating load of 250 was established 4 due to limitations in cyclone classification efficiency.

Mainly in USA the term circulating load is more often used than the circulation factor.Circulating load is percentage of coarse return in relation to fines it can be calculated by Coarse return TPH X 100 / Mill output TPH.Normal range of cirulating load in a conventional close circuit ball mill is around .
